Q: Is 134,252,044 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 134,252,044 is not a prime number.

Why is 134,252,044 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 134252044 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 107 181 214 362 428 724 1,733 3,466 6,932 19,367 38,734 77,468 185,431 313,673 370,862 627,346 741,724 1,254,692 33,563,011 67,126,022 and 134,252,044, with no remainder.

Since 134,252,044 cannot be divided by just 1 and 134,252,044, it is not a prime number.
